Train UI

A live NYC train display I built in two sizes

Builds Data


Overview

I built Train UI so I could see the next trains without opening an app. Pick a train and station once, then leave the display running.

How it works

Both versions connect directly to the MTA's public realtime feeds. Your train and station stay saved on the device, which refreshes arrivals, service status, weather, time, and connection information without a phone app, account, or API key.

Choose a version

Train UI XL Train UI Mini
Train UI XL showing live departures Train UI Mini e-paper display
Raspberry Pi Zero W and a 10.1-inch color screen ESP32-S3 and a 2.13-inch e-paper screen
Full dashboard, weather, and Pi health Smaller, cheaper, and simpler

XL CAD files

File Use
case for screen.step Full STEP assembly for reference and editing
Only 3DP files.step Only the parts that need to be 3D printed
case for screen.f3z Editable Fusion 360 archive

Use Only 3DP files.step when you only want the printable enclosure pieces. It leaves out the reference electronics and hardware from the full assembly.

What they show

  • Arrivals in both directions
  • MTA service status and alerts
  • Weather, time, and connection status
  • Live public data with no API key

For a bar or other across-the-room installation, use the separate Train UI XL Trackside edition.
